Back at Castle Dedede, the thieves place Lovely into the [[Monster Delivery System]] and request that [[Night Mare Enterprises|N.M.E.]] transform it into a [[monster]], explaining that they intend to use it to destroy Whispy Woods. With the deed done, they leave Lovely in a conspicuous place in the castle for the kids to find and return to the forest with. The kids re-plant Lovely in the mound - much to Whispy's gratitude - when the flower begins to speak. With her newfound power of speech, Lovely begins to infatuate Whispy, causing him to grow even more obsessed with her. Seeing this, Tiff and Tuff begin to grow suspicious, but they nonetheless leave Whispy and Lovely alone for the moment. Later that evening at the castle, [[Sir Ebrum]] and [[Lady Like]] become worried that Tiff and Tuff have still not come home, so they send [[Lololo & Lalala (anime characters)|Fololo & Falala]] to go find them.
